首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PHP服务器接口

是一种用于构建动态网页和Web应用程序的后端开发语言。它具有简单易学、开发效率高、跨平台兼容性好的特点,被广泛应用于Web开发领域。

PHP服务器接口的分类可以根据不同的用途和功能进行划分,包括:

  1. Web服务器模块:PHP可以通过与常见的Web服务器(如Apache、Nginx等)进行集成,作为服务器模块进行使用。通过配置相应的Web服务器模块,可以实现对PHP脚本的解析和执行。
  2. 命令行工具:PHP提供了一些命令行工具,如PHP CLI(Command Line Interface),可以在命令行界面下直接执行PHP脚本,方便开发人员进行脚本调试、批量处理等操作。
  3. CGI(Common Gateway Interface):PHP也可以以CGI模式运行,即通过Web服务器与其他外部程序进行交互。通过CGI接口,PHP可以与数据库、文件系统等进行数据交互,并生成动态的网页内容。

PHP服务器接口的优势主要包括:

  1. 简单易学:PHP语法类似于C语言,易于学习和掌握,降低了初学者的门槛。
  2. 开发效率高:PHP提供了丰富的内置函数和第三方扩展库,可以快速实现常见的开发任务,提高开发效率。
  3. 跨平台兼容性好:PHP可以在多种操作系统(如Windows、Linux、Mac等)上运行,并且与各种数据库(如MySQL、Oracle、SQL Server等)兼容性良好。

PHP服务器接口的应用场景包括:

  1. 动态网页开发:PHP可以嵌入HTML代码,通过与前端技术结合,实现动态网页的生成和交互。
  2. Web应用程序开发:PHP提供了丰富的功能和工具,可以用于开发各种规模的Web应用程序,包括电子商务平台、社交网络、内容管理系统等。
  3. 数据处理和存储:PHP具有良好的数据库支持,可以与各种数据库进行交互,进行数据的存储、查询、更新等操作。

腾讯云提供了适用于PHP服务器接口的相关产品和服务,推荐的产品包括:

  1. 云服务器(CVM):提供稳定可靠的云服务器实例,可选择不同的配置和规格,满足不同规模的应用需求。产品介绍链接: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L:提供高性能、高可靠性的云数据库服务,支持与PHP的无缝集成,方便进行数据存储和管理。产品介绍链接:https://cloud.tencent.com/product/cdb_mysql
  3. 云函数(SCF):提供事件驱动的无服务器计算服务,可用于处理PHP脚本的执行和事件触发。产品介绍链接:https://cloud.tencent.com/product/scf

通过使用这些腾讯云产品,可以轻松构建和部署基于PHP服务器接口的Web应用程序,并获得良好的性能和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• PHP面向对象-接口

    接口接口是一种特殊的抽象类,它只包含抽象方法。接口中定义的所有方法都必须在实现该接口的类中被实现。一个类可以实现多个接口,但只能继承一个类。...定义一个接口使用 interface 关键字:interface Animal { public function makeSound();}在上面的示例中,我们定义了一个接口 Animal,它只包含一个抽象方法...; }}在上面的示例中,我们定义了一个类 Dog,它实现了 Animal 接口,并实现了 makeSound() 方法。接口的作用是为类提供一个公共的接口,从而实现代码的复用和多态性。...通过实现接口,我们可以确保不同的类实现了相同的方法,从而让它们可以互相替换,增强了程序的灵活性。...常量在接口中是不能被修改的,因此我们可以在接口中定义一些公共的常量,从而实现代码的复用和统一性。

    1.7K31

    php接口入门

    格式转化 学习了php的基本语法的你们肯定知道数组Array这个基本数据啦,因为我们前端显示出的数据库数据一般由数组表示的,那么基本数据数组和JSON之间要怎么转换呢?...json四原则: “:”:数据在名称/值对中 “,”:数据由逗号分隔 “{ }”:花括号保存对象 “[ ]”:方括号保存数组 写php接口 个人写接口的时间不长,从网上资料及视频教程中得出经验:写简单接口...php接口知识 (如若手机显示不全,可右滑) interface Animal{ public function bite(); } class Man implements People{...\r\n"; 接口存在的意义就是实现“多重继承”,准确的来说应该就做“多重实现“,因为一个php类只能有一个父类,而一个类却可以实现多个接口,就像大一学C++时,上面代码interface.php中的Hybreed...登录注册api接口实例 (如若手机显示不全,可右滑) //数据库连接部分--开始 $mysql_server_name="localhost"; //数据库服务器名称 $mysql_username="

    10K81

    PHP接口性能优化

    首屏接口性能的好坏,将直接影响到app的使用体验。 我们服务端RPC框架采用RESTful,其底层是curl实现的。curl采用http协议的,另外我们服务端的技术栈是PHP。...我们都知道http协议相比较TCP而言,不仅多了http的报头,PHP本身性能也是大问题。在不做大重构的情况下,怎么做最小的修改,完成最大的性能提高。还是很有挑战性的。...现在只需要拿到第一屏的接口,即可完成界面的渲染工作。...分屏后第一屏接口耗时 [这里写图片描述] 分屏后第二屏接口耗时 [这里写图片描述] xhprof性能分析 通过在alpha坏境和beta坏境部署Xhprof性能分析工具。...实际结果可看下图 第二次优化第一屏接口耗时 [第一屏接口] 第二次优化第二屏接口耗时 [第二屏接口] 希望转载的朋友能够尊重作者的劳动成果,加上转载地址。谢谢!

    2.6K70

    PHP通信接口大坑集锦

    前情提要 最近因为毕设在搭建接口及数据库环境,使用Apache+MySQL+PHP在阿里云ECS服务器中配置,之前在本地配置过并成功实现,但是在阿里云中却频频出错,记录下配置过程中遇到的坑,方便后来人借鉴参考...无法解析,网页显示源代码 情况描述:笔者先后使用apt install指令下载了Apache2和PHP7.0,然后通过scp指令将本地编写好的PHP通信接口上传到阿里云主机的/var/www/html目录下...,通过网址在浏览器中查看接口的部署情况,发现网页显示的是PHP源码。...# PHP去掉警告 情况描述:笔者在运行php接口脚本的时候发现页面上页面上显示了PHP的warning,这些警告对运行没有影响,但是显示在页面上对移动端的数据解析会有影响,所以这个警告需要去除。...获取数据库中文乱码 情况描述:后端接口从数据库获取的中文数据全变成问号?

    1.2K20

    php接口安全设计浅谈

    接口的安全性主要围绕Token、Timestamp和Sign三个机制展开设计,保证接口的数据不会被篡改和重复调用,下面具体来看: (1)Token授权机制:(**Token是客户端访问服务端的凭证)--...**用户使用用户名密码登录后服务器给客户端返回一个Token(通常是UUID),并将Token-UserId以键值对的形式存放在缓存服务器中。...系统参数 $systemParam=getAllHeadersParam(); //接受body数据--业务参数(json格式) $data=file_get_contents('php...sign']; //签名 $arr['source'] =$systemParam['source']; //来源(0-安卓/1-IOS/2-H5/3-PC/4-php...$_SERVER ['REQUEST_URI']; } return $url; } 复制代码 非法ip限制访问,此处的限制一般用在服务器间的接口调用做此限制 // 允许访问的IP列表

    1.1K10
    领券